โฆ Table of Contents
Content:
Contributors
Pages vii-viii
Preface
Pages ix-xi
Techniques in multirate digital control Original Research Article
Pages 1-24
Hamed M. Al-Rahmani, Gene F. Franklin
The design of digital pole placement controllers Original Research Article
Pages 25-65
Michel Kinnaert, Youbin Peng
Linearization techniques for pulse width control of linear systems Original Research Article
Pages 67-111
F. Bernelli-Zazzera, P. Mantegazza
Algorithms for discretization and continualization of MIMO state space representations Original Research Article
Pages 113-161
Stanoje Bingulac, Hugh F. VanLandingham
Discrete-time control systems design via loop transfer recovery Original Research Article
Pages 163-198
Tadashi Ishihara
The study of discrete singularly perturbed linear-quadratic control systems Original Research Article
Pages 199-242
Zoran Gajic, Myotaeg Lim, Xuemin Shen
Modeling techniques and control architectures for machining intelligence Original Research Article
Pages 243-289
Allan D. Spence, Yusuf Altintas
Techniques in discrete-time position control of flexible one arm robots Original Research Article
Pages 291-351
Sijun Wu, Magne Tek, Sabri Cetinkunt
Pole assignment by memoryless periodic output feedback Original Research Article
Pages 353-378
Dirk Aeyels, Jacques L. Willems
Index
Pages 379-383
